Establishes the Farming and Workforce Development Program to train eligible individuals for seasonal crop farming.
The bill creates the Farming and Workforce Development Program, which will provide training to eligible individuals for seasonal crop farming. The program is open to those aged 16 to 35 who are Ohio residents, including those with felony convictions. Each county office of the Ohio State University Extension and Central State University Extension will develop guidelines and policies for the application process, training coursework, and program implementation. The program is funded with a $500,000 appropriation from the General Revenue Fund.
